What Led to This Significant Shift?
Several factors have contributed to this dramatic change in illegal crossing patterns:
- Increased Border Patrol Presence: Enhanced enforcement in California has led many to seek alternative routes.
- Economic Opportunities in Texas: With a booming job market, Texas attracts individuals looking for a better life.
- Escalation of Violence in Home Countries: Ongoing conflicts and violence have forced many to flee for safety.

The Impact on Texas Communities
The influx of individuals seeking refuge and opportunity has had both positive and negative effects on Texas communities. Local economies have seen growth due to an increase in labor, but challenges have also arisen:
- Strain on Resources: Schools, healthcare, and housing are facing increased demands.
- Cultural Enrichment: The diverse backgrounds of these new residents have contributed to a vibrant cultural tapestry.
- Political Tension: The issue of illegal crossings has become a hot-button topic in local and state politics.
